Home
last modified time | relevance | path

Searched refs:BitShift (Results 1 – 10 of 10) sorted by relevance

/external/swiftshader/third_party/llvm-7.0/llvm/lib/Support/
DAPInt.cpp928 unsigned BitShift = ShiftAmt % APINT_BITS_PER_WORD; in ashrSlowCase() local
937 if (BitShift == 0) { in ashrSlowCase()
942 U.pVal[i] = (U.pVal[i + WordShift] >> BitShift) | in ashrSlowCase()
943 (U.pVal[i + WordShift + 1] << (APINT_BITS_PER_WORD - BitShift)); in ashrSlowCase()
946 U.pVal[WordsToMove - 1] = U.pVal[WordShift + WordsToMove - 1] >> BitShift; in ashrSlowCase()
949 SignExtend64(U.pVal[WordsToMove - 1], APINT_BITS_PER_WORD - BitShift); in ashrSlowCase()
2565 unsigned BitShift = Count % APINT_BITS_PER_WORD; in tcShiftLeft() local
2568 if (BitShift == 0) { in tcShiftLeft()
2572 Dst[Words] = Dst[Words - WordShift] << BitShift; in tcShiftLeft()
2575 Dst[Words - WordShift - 1] >> (APINT_BITS_PER_WORD - BitShift); in tcShiftLeft()
[all …]
/external/llvm/lib/Transforms/Utils/
DLocal.cpp1788 unsigned BitShift = in collectBitParts() local
1791 if (BitShift > BitWidth) in collectBitParts()
1803 P.erase(std::prev(P.end(), BitShift), P.end()); in collectBitParts()
1804 P.insert(P.begin(), BitShift, BitPart::Unset); in collectBitParts()
1806 P.erase(P.begin(), std::next(P.begin(), BitShift)); in collectBitParts()
1807 P.insert(P.end(), BitShift, BitPart::Unset); in collectBitParts()
/external/swiftshader/third_party/llvm-7.0/llvm/lib/Transforms/Utils/
DLocal.cpp2543 unsigned BitShift = in collectBitParts() local
2546 if (BitShift > BitWidth) in collectBitParts()
2558 P.erase(std::prev(P.end(), BitShift), P.end()); in collectBitParts()
2559 P.insert(P.begin(), BitShift, BitPart::Unset); in collectBitParts()
2561 P.erase(P.begin(), std::next(P.begin(), BitShift)); in collectBitParts()
2562 P.insert(P.end(), BitShift, BitPart::Unset); in collectBitParts()
/external/llvm/lib/Target/SystemZ/
DSystemZISelLowering.cpp3238 SDValue BitShift = DAG.getNode(ISD::SHL, DL, PtrVT, Addr, in lowerATOMIC_LOAD_OP() local
3240 BitShift = DAG.getNode(ISD::TRUNCATE, DL, WideVT, BitShift); in lowerATOMIC_LOAD_OP()
3245 DAG.getConstant(0, DL, WideVT), BitShift); in lowerATOMIC_LOAD_OP()
3262 SDValue Ops[] = { ChainIn, AlignedAddr, Src2, BitShift, NegBitShift, in lowerATOMIC_LOAD_OP()
3269 SDValue ResultShift = DAG.getNode(ISD::ADD, DL, WideVT, BitShift, in lowerATOMIC_LOAD_OP()
3342 SDValue BitShift = DAG.getNode(ISD::SHL, DL, PtrVT, Addr, in lowerATOMIC_CMP_SWAP() local
3344 BitShift = DAG.getNode(ISD::TRUNCATE, DL, WideVT, BitShift); in lowerATOMIC_CMP_SWAP()
3349 DAG.getConstant(0, DL, WideVT), BitShift); in lowerATOMIC_CMP_SWAP()
3353 SDValue Ops[] = { ChainIn, AlignedAddr, CmpVal, SwapVal, BitShift, in lowerATOMIC_CMP_SWAP()
5326 unsigned BitShift = (IsSubWord ? MI.getOperand(4).getReg() : 0); in emitAtomicLoadBinary() local
[all …]
/external/swiftshader/third_party/llvm-7.0/llvm/lib/Target/SystemZ/
DSystemZISelLowering.cpp3462 SDValue BitShift = DAG.getNode(ISD::SHL, DL, PtrVT, Addr, in lowerATOMIC_LOAD_OP() local
3464 BitShift = DAG.getNode(ISD::TRUNCATE, DL, WideVT, BitShift); in lowerATOMIC_LOAD_OP()
3469 DAG.getConstant(0, DL, WideVT), BitShift); in lowerATOMIC_LOAD_OP()
3486 SDValue Ops[] = { ChainIn, AlignedAddr, Src2, BitShift, NegBitShift, in lowerATOMIC_LOAD_OP()
3493 SDValue ResultShift = DAG.getNode(ISD::ADD, DL, WideVT, BitShift, in lowerATOMIC_LOAD_OP()
3578 SDValue BitShift = DAG.getNode(ISD::SHL, DL, PtrVT, Addr, in lowerATOMIC_CMP_SWAP() local
3580 BitShift = DAG.getNode(ISD::TRUNCATE, DL, WideVT, BitShift); in lowerATOMIC_CMP_SWAP()
3585 DAG.getConstant(0, DL, WideVT), BitShift); in lowerATOMIC_CMP_SWAP()
3589 SDValue Ops[] = { ChainIn, AlignedAddr, CmpVal, SwapVal, BitShift, in lowerATOMIC_CMP_SWAP()
6301 unsigned BitShift = (IsSubWord ? MI.getOperand(4).getReg() : 0); in emitAtomicLoadBinary() local
[all …]
/external/swiftshader/third_party/llvm-7.0/llvm/lib/Analysis/
DConstantFolding.cpp68 unsigned BitShift = DL.getTypeSizeInBits(SrcEltTy); in foldConstVectorToAPInt() local
77 Result <<= BitShift; in foldConstVectorToAPInt()
85 Result <<= BitShift; in foldConstVectorToAPInt()
/external/swiftshader/third_party/llvm-7.0/llvm/lib/Target/AMDGPU/
DR600ISelLowering.cpp1286 SDValue BitShift = DAG.getNode(ISD::SHL, DL, VT, ByteIndex, in LowerSTORE() local
1290 SDValue Mask = DAG.getNode(ISD::SHL, DL, VT, MaskConstant, BitShift); in LowerSTORE()
1294 SDValue ShiftedValue = DAG.getNode(ISD::SHL, DL, VT, TruncValue, BitShift); in LowerSTORE()
/external/llvm/lib/Analysis/
DConstantFolding.cpp84 unsigned BitShift = DL.getTypeSizeInBits(SrcEltTy); in FoldBitCast() local
97 Result <<= BitShift; in FoldBitCast()
/external/swiftshader/third_party/LLVM/lib/CodeGen/SelectionDAG/
DLegalizeDAG.cpp1921 unsigned BitShift = LoadTy.getSizeInBits() - in ExpandFCOPYSIGN() local
1923 assert(BitShift < LoadTy.getSizeInBits() && "Pointer advanced wrong?"); in ExpandFCOPYSIGN()
1924 if (BitShift) in ExpandFCOPYSIGN()
1926 DAG.getConstant(BitShift, in ExpandFCOPYSIGN()
/external/swiftshader/third_party/llvm-7.0/llvm/lib/CodeGen/SelectionDAG/
DDAGCombiner.cpp5665 uint64_t BitShift = ShiftOp->getZExtValue(); in calculateByteProvider() local
5666 if (BitShift % 8 != 0) in calculateByteProvider()
5668 uint64_t ByteShift = BitShift / 8; in calculateByteProvider()